The 2025 AFL Grand Final is being shown live and free on Channel 7 and 7plus in Australia , with Watch AFL carrying the international broadcast.

Key ways to watch in 2025

  • Free-to-air TV (Australia):
    • Broadcast exclusively live on Channel 7 across Australia.
* Coverage starts from the early afternoon, with main match coverage from **2:00pm AEST** and first bounce at **2:30pm AEST**.
  • Streaming in Australia:
    • You can stream the Grand Final free on 7plus , Channel 7’s streaming platform, in 1080p HD (no pay subscription needed, but you may need an account).
  • Outside Australia (overseas viewers):
    • The match is available via Watch AFL , the official international streaming service for AFL.
* Watch AFL offers live and on-demand streams of the Grand Final and may be available as a standalone pass for finals.
  • Radio and live coverage:
    • ABC Sport provides live radio commentary via local radio, the ABC Listen app, and its website.
* AFL’s own site and various sports outlets run live blogs and text commentary.

Public live sites & fan zones

  • Melbourne (MCG & CBD):
    • The game is played at the MCG.
* For those without tickets, **Federation Square in the Melbourne CBD screens the Grand Final live from around midday** as a public fan site.
  • Geelong:
    • Fans can watch at Eastern Beach Reserve in Geelong, with festivities from 12pm leading into the 2:30pm AEST bounce.
  • Brisbane:
    • The Brisbane Lions’ official watch party is held at New Farm Park , running roughly 8:30am–6pm , showing the game live and free on big screens.
